Smart Youngsters Seen At Wingatui

“The Preus" Special Service

DUNEDIN. August 21. Rondabelle, a neat filly by Bellborough from the Treasure Hunt mare Rondel, was the moat Impressive two-year-old which paraded at the Otago Hunt's meeting on Saturday. The imported sire Bellborough, which is standing at the Hampton bodge Stud at Invercargill. was also represented by the runner-up in the first division, Mrs W. Robertson's chestnut gelding, and by the filly from Carillon, which won the second division. Rondabelle is trained at Wingatui by R. Heasley for her Dunedin breeder. Mr E. C. S. Falconer, who is at present overseas. She is a granddaughter of the IM3 McLean Stakes winner, Lyndall, which was a half-sis-ter by Man’s Pal to the brilliant sprinter Irish Note, which holds the Canterbury Jockey Club’s Riccarton racecourse record of Imin Osec for six furlongs. Ridden by R. J. Skelton, Rondabelle started brilliantly, but bounded over to the rails. She was never headed and won by four lengths.

Mrs W. Roberteon’e gelding is trained by H. A. Anderton, who also prepares the Bellborough filly from Carillon. Salericho, the dam of Mrs Robertson's gelding. ia by Salmagundi from the Jericho mare. Jericho Jane. Salericho was bred by Mr W. Croekett. at Palmerston. Blue Rose was next to finish, ahead Of Golden Craze. A filly by Blueskin from the Resurgent mare, Rising High. Blue Rose was purchased at the Trentham yearling sales by Mr B. F. Waters. Lower Hutt, for 3M guineas. She is trained by D. G. O'Neill. One of the best of her family was Gold Medal, winner of the Anniversary and January Handicaps at Trentham Golden Craze is trained by A. N. Didham for his Dunedin breeder Mr J. Palmer. He is a half-brother by Messmate to Corvale.

The fiily from Carillon was bred by her Southland owners. Messrs E. J. and H. D. Irving, who raced Carillon, a Lo Zingaro mare.

The filly showed early speed to beat the Castle Donnington coltprepared by B. J- Cochrane at Gore for his Dunedin own'ers, Messrs R. J. Gilbert and C. H. S. Stevens. He was bred by Mr C. E. Larsen, vice-president of the Forbury Park Trotting Club.

By Pride of Kildare, Lady Kildare is a member of the famous "March’’ family. Regal Birthday, a filly by Harken from Royal Birthday, is trained by A. I. Powell for her Gore breeder, Mr T. M. Kelly. She is a half-sister to Birthright and the smart galloper Happy Birthday Fourth in this division was Mr J. Cook's colt by Wedgewood from Supermarine He is trained by A. N. Didham. He was bred by his owner at Wyndham. There were eight runners in the first division and nine in the second. The sprint was over two furlongs. Stalls were not used.
